Abstract
The synthesis of Ileu^5^‐hypertensin II‐Asp‐β‐amide, L‐Asparaginyl‐L‐arginyl‐L‐valyl‐L‐tyrosyl‐L‐isoleucyl‐L‐histidyl‐L‐prolyl‐L‐phenylalanine, is described. The highly purified octapeptide is 5 to 10 times as active as noradrenaline on the blood pressure of the rat in the experimental set‐up of Peart^9^), and 2 to 4 times as active as Val^5^‐ hypertensin I, isolated from bovine plasma^3^).
